We orchestrate the work. We never hold the data.
Polnor runs across two planes. The control plane, operated by us, schedules and compiles work. The data plane, your cloud, your compute, your storage, is where everything actually executes. Instructions cross the boundary in one direction. Patient data crosses it in neither.
At Polnor there is nothing to exfiltrate. Your data never leaves your cloud: the control plane orchestrates the processing, but sees and stores no patient data. Our attack surface is not yours, and yours does not extend to us.

Your cloud, your region, an HDS-certified host
Polnor deploys into your own OVHcloud or Scaleway account. The data is created and stored where you choose, within your existing controls, on infrastructure operated by an HDS-certified host. Cloud credentials are encrypted, residency is configurable, and every access to health data is logged.

A generalist made "health-compatible" still runs on their cloud
Retrofitting a general-purpose platform for healthcare does not change where the data lives. You configure their environment, ingest into their tenancy, and depend on their region and their controls. With Polnor, the platform comes to your cloud, you remain both the owner and the operator of your data.
